Jasper Engine

Took the car to the shop today.. Diagnosis... spun rod bearing. Thank god its still under warranty. so i just took off all of my goodies to get it fixed :D
Anyways. what i cant take out is the intense pcm. I think what they are planning on doing is ordering a new motor from jasper and installing it,(it would be cheaper then rebuilding the whole engine again). What i was wondering is if they do that am I going to have to have the pcm reprogrammed again? Or am i just going to have to have the case learn done again??? Thanks
